NeoDeco Glitchwave lives at the edge of structure and style.
Each image pairs a stylized figure—woman, man, or something between—with an abstracted world that reflects their shape, mood, and presence. These aren’t cutouts pasted on cityscapes. They’re connected, fused, built from the same visual tension.
Inspired by the bold geometry of ‘80s graphic art and the elegance of Art Deco, this style leans into contrast—color, silhouette, texture. Red and teal have dominated recently, but the palette shifts by design. This isn’t about repetition. It’s about force.
